Output e43459670227bb852f853e01ab0975b63dff9c32b065ad075a84280cd7e7a898:0

value
631392
script pubkey
OP_0 OP_PUSHBYTES_20 89b38e7973e36ea2c4392336e85b88e36dd35937
address
bc1q3xecu7tnudh293peyvmwskugudkaxkfhm90v9v
transaction
e43459670227bb852f853e01ab0975b63dff9c32b065ad075a84280cd7e7a898
spent
true